She likes playing the violin. vs She likes to play violin.

Both phrases are correct, but they are used in slightly different contexts. "She likes playing the violin" is more commonly used and emphasizes the activity of playing the violin as a hobby or interest. On the other hand, "She likes to play the violin" is also correct and emphasizes the action of playing the violin. Both can be used depending on the context and personal preference.

She likes playing the violin.

This phrase is correct and commonly used in English.

This phrase is used to express someone's enjoyment or interest in playing the violin as an activity or hobby.

Examples:

  • She likes playing the violin in her free time.
  • I know she likes playing the violin because she practices every day.
  • Playing the violin is something she really enjoys.
  • He discovered his passion for playing the violin at a young age.
  • The concert showcased talented musicians playing the violin.

She likes to play violin.

This phrase is correct and commonly used in English.

This phrase is used to express someone's preference or inclination to engage in the action of playing the violin.

Examples:

  • She likes to play violin whenever she feels stressed.
  • I can tell she likes to play violin because she always has a smile on her face when she does.
  • To relax, she likes to play violin in the evenings.
  • Playing violin is something she likes to do to unwind.
  • She likes to play violin as a way to express her emotions.
